J5/592/S was first registered on 8th February 1936 and is amongst the very last of the Mk IIs produced. Initially supplied via Messrs A Watson & Co of Liverpool to its first owner; Mr J Herron of Cheshire. The next recorded owner was Mr R J Stokes of East Sheen, London, who bought the car in 1950 and actively campaigned it in AMOC concours e..
Originally known for producing some of the world’s finest firearms, Austrian manufacturer Steyr diversified into automobile production in 1915. The 220 model was introduced in 1937 as a larger-displacement evolution of the six-cylinder 120 that debuted three years prior. Power from inline six-cylinder OHV engine with capacity of 2.3 lite..
